Jul 01, 1996 Crushed stone dust acts as a filler in the concrete and contributes to reduce the absorption of concrete. However, increasing the dust content more than 15% causes an increase in absorption which is a parallel leading with compressive strength.
MoreCrusher dust is a fine material formed during the process of comminution of rock into crushed stone or crushed sand. This dust is composed by particles which pass 75 μm BS sieve. Effects of dust content in aggregate on properties of fresh and hardened concrete are not known very well.

MoreJul 01, 2003 Basically, mineral filler replaced sand. The effect of applying different amounts of mineral filler on concrete was then determined. The addition of 7–10% of mineral filler to fine aggregate (0–2 mm) was found to considerably improve the properties of concrete.

MoreApr 01, 1972 A publication titled Stone Sand by J. E. Gray and J. E. Bell, National Crushed Stone Association, Engineering Bulletin No. 13, 1964 discusses the effect of dust on the properties of concrete. Basically, dust affects the bond between the cement and aggregate so that compressive strength can be considerably reduced, and the dust material ...

MoreNov 11, 2019 Crushed stone: If you hear the generic “crushed stone” term, it usually refers to stone that has a mixture of stone dust in it. This type of stone is best used for a base when heavy compaction is needed. As a result, it is typically used for the base of concrete and paving projects, foundations of structures, and driveway bases.
